22:53 CET - Results are starting to come in from tonight's Champions League and it has been a good night for Tottenham, who have cruised to a 3-0 victory over Slavia Prague, whilst there were wins for Atletico Madrid and Atalanta as they chase progression into the next round.

Marseille have also picked up all three points, resisting a second-half comeback from Royale Union SG to win the game 3-2. An unlucky night for the Belgian side, who saw two goals ruled out by VAR late on.

20:39 CET  - Bayern Munich have come from a goal down against Sporting Lisbon to claim a 3-1 win, bouncing back from defeat at Arsenal to move back up to second place in the Champions League table.

18:21 CET - Olympiacos have edged Kairat Almaty 1-0 over in Kazakhstan to notch their first win of the league phase to move up to 26th and just one point off the playoff spots.

The Greek side absolutely battered their hosts statistically, taking 20 shots and notching an xG of 2.37, but they almost didn’t get the job in Astana, where the game was being held.

Kairat, meanwhile, are almost surely out of playoff contention now; they have just one point to their name.
